您没有访问所请求对象的必要权限,或者无法从服务器读取该对象

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了您没有访问所请求对象的必要权限,或者无法从服务器读取该对象相关的知识,希望对你有一定的参考价值。

我在我的电脑上安装了xampp,我刚刚完成了:

sudo chmod -R 777 ./project

所以我项目中的所有文件都有777个权限。

但是当我尝试访问包含css的文件夹时:

http://localhost:1580/project/application/css

我获得:

您没有访问所请求对象的必要权限,或者无法从服务器读取该对象。

有人可以帮帮我吗?

答案

当Apache HTTP收到解析为目录的URL的请求时,它将尝试查找索引文件。

它将查看使用DirectoryIndex directive指定的名称列表,并尝试提供它找到匹配的第一个名称。

此时您可能会遇到权限问题,但由于您已将文件权限设置为777,因此您不应该这样做。

如果找不到匹配项,则可能会使用mod_autoindex生成目录列表。

如果the Options directive包括+Indexes,它只会这样做。


如果是你的情况,听起来你没有索引文件(为什么你会在CSS中?)并且如果你的选项没有启用索引。

以上是关于您没有访问所请求对象的必要权限,或者无法从服务器读取该对象的主要内容,如果未能解决你的问题,请参考以下文章

无法访问。您可能没有权限使用网络资源。请与这台服务器的管理员联系以查明您是不是有访问权限。

您指定的网页无法访问! 错误类型:403

打开就出现:错误提示为:“无法连接到 WMI 提供程序。您没有权限或者该服务器无法访问。请注意,你只能使

sqlserver2019更新时报错无法为该请求检索数据

打开SQL Server 配置管理器时出现了问题 ,无法连接到WMI提供程序,您没有权限或者该服务器无法访问

(GCS) 查看此对象的元数据所需的其他权限:请求对象所有者授予您“storage.objects.get”权限